水玻璃型砂输送皮带在运行过程中,由于水玻璃的粘性作用,在型砂输送到各个造型点以后,皮带上还残存有少量型砂,因水玻璃型砂自硬较快,一般2~3小时残留型砂就能硬化.在连续造型生产的情况下,这些残型砂越积越多,从而在皮带表面上形成一层粘砂层.这种粘砂层不但很难消除,而且对生产与设备都有很大危害.1.使皮带柔韧性降低,表面易于撕裂,缩短了皮带使用寿命;2.皮带重量增加,使电机长期超负荷运行,影响电机使用寿命;3.造成皮带长期跑偏,加剧皮带的磨损;4.降低了型砂质量,增加铸件废品率;5.操作、维修工作人员工作量增大,并且停产时间增多,影响产值.
